This is basically going to be my ongoing project for as long as I am building stuff. The city's name "Kismet" is a word that means fate and fortune. I started this city alongside a river, as many real cities began. There is no limit to how big this city will ge. I am trying to make this similar to a city in the real world, without all the unnecessary parts for minecraft such as parking lots, cars, and such. If you have any suggestions/comments PLEASE do so.
